Abstract
Background: Pelvic girdle pain (PGP) represents a prevalent musculoskeletal condition among gravid women, manifesting as discomfort in the pelvic articulations, sacroiliac joints, or symphysis pubis. This condition substantially compromises functional capacity, activities of daily living, and psychosocial health. Despite being frequently dismissed as an inherent component of gestation, considerable prevalence and associated morbidity necessitate comprehensive research. Objectives: This study aimed to evaluate the determinants associated with pelvic girdle pain among expectant mothers receiving care. Materials and Methods: A cross-sectional descriptive study was undertaken with 100 pregnant women in their third trimester attending designated Primary Health Centers in Sulaymaniyah City from February 6, 2024, to May 13, 2024. Data acquisition employed semi-structured questionnaires, pain assessment scales, and the Pelvic Girdle Questionnaire. Results: The prevalence of pregnancy-related pelvic girdle pain (PPGP) reached 79%. Statistically significant correlations emerged between PPGP and variables including educational attainment, occupational status, parity, gestational age, and occupational physical demands, particularly repetitive lifting activities. Conversely, maternal age, body mass index, gravidity, and socioeconomic status demonstrated no significant associations. Functional impairments secondary to PGP were predominantly observed in postural activities including standing, flexion movements, ambulation, and domestic responsibilities. A substantial percentage of participants reported absence of regular physical exercise or pelvic floor muscle training protocols. Conclusions: PGP demonstrates high prevalence among pregnant women, with significant correlations to physical activity patterns, parity, and occupational factors. These findings underscore the imperative for early detection protocols, comprehensive patient education initiatives, and prophylactic interventions incorporating specialized physiotherapy and exercise programs.
